The Software Engineering Specialist will guide the design and development of our Power Distribution and Protection technologies. This role includes creating strategies, direction, and priorities to develop constructive solutions aligning to the business needs. There will be a large emphasis on innovation, software architecture, component design and tools.

Essential Functions:
- Create solutions for software architecture design, component design, development tools and process standards
- Coordinate multi-disciplined engineering projects from design to implementation
- Provide technical leadership to the software developers and other cross functional disciplines
- Support all phases of the software development lifecycle (Requirements, Design, Coding, Testing)
- Support continuous improvement initiatives for processes, software development and tool adoption
- On-site customer support, as needed
- Stay abreast of hybrid/electric and Power Distribution and Protection technologies

Qualifications
Required (Basic) Qualifications:
- Bachelorâs degree in Electrical and/or Computer Engineering, Electronics Engineering, or Computer Science.
- Minimum of seven (7) yearsâ experience in embedded software development with C/C++
- Minimum of two (2) years of working knowledge of vehicle communication protocols such as CAN/CAN-FD, SPI and test tools (CANoe, CanKing, Logic Analyzer, etc.)
- Minimum of five (5) years of experience with full life cycle software development including requirements, design, coding, and testing.
- Legally authorized to work in the US without company sponsorship, on an ongoing basis.
- Candidates must reside within 50 miles of either the Tualatin, OR or Southfield MI locations. Relocation services are not available.
Preferred Qualifications:
- Thorough understanding of software architecture design, algorithms, data structures and multithreading concepts
- Experience with a variety of CPU architectures and low-level drivers for microcontroller peripheral interfaces such as SPI, I2C, UART, ADC, I/O, etc
- Experience developing software using an RTOS
- Experience working with oscilloscopes, multimeters, and power supplies
- Working experience with developing software in compliance with AUTOSAR, ASPICE and MISRA standards
- Working knowledge of OEM or Tier1 development process
- Experience with ISO26262 and safety product development
- Experience developing Power Distribution and Protection products is a plus
- Working experience with DOORS is a plus
